Sound Transit to host public meeting about new North Sammamish Park-and-Ride

Public invited to view and comment on potential sites for a new park-and-ride to improve transit access for Sammamish residents

Sound Transit will hold an open house on July 11 about a planned park-and-ride in the northern end of the City of Sammamish that will connect to local and regional transit options. This new park-and-ride will provide up to 200 parking spaces, and will be open in 2024.

  • Thursday, July 11, from 6-8 p.m. at Sammamish City Hall, 801 228th Ave. SE, Sammamish; presentation at 6:30 p.m.

The park-and-ride lot will be built within the Sound Transit district, along the 228th Avenue NE/Sahalee Way Northeast transit corridor, north of Southeast 8th Street. Sound Transit will determine the exact location of this facility in partnership with the City of Sammamish and King County Metro.

Members of the public can learn about proposed park-and-ride locations and Sound Transit's process and schedule for selecting a site; provide feedback, and talk to Sound Transit staff.
